Mumbai, March 13 (NationPress) Actress Shilpa Shirodkar, who has recently captured attention again with her participation in the reality series 'Bigg Boss 18', requested blessings as she embarks on her journey with the forthcoming film 'Jatadhara', featuring Sudheer Babu and Sonakshi Sinha.
Shilpa shared a video montage on her Instagram, showcasing moments of her offering prayers alongside the film's crew. The montage included heartwarming scenes of Shilpa engaging in conversations and receiving a warm reception in the hotel lobby.
“And it begins… No better way to start something new with blessings and positivity #Jatadhara #ShilpaShirodkar #SudhirBabu #SonakshiSinha,” she captioned the post.
On March 11, a behind-the-scenes (BTS) image featuring Shilpa from the film circulated online. In this photo, she appeared joyful and proudly showcased her look from the film.
'Jatadhara' is a supernatural thriller that explores the unknown, promising to deliver an exhilarating experience for audiences. With its distinctive plot and skilled cast, including Shilpa Shirodkar, this film is predicted to create a significant impact in the film industry.
'Jatadhara' is being produced by Zee Studios' Umesh KR Bansal, Prerna Arora, Aruna Agarwal, and Shivin Narang. It is co-produced by Akshay Kejriwal and Kussum Arora, with Creative Producers Divya Vijay and Sagar Ambre.
Meanwhile, Sonakshi and the rest of the cast have commenced filming in Mount Abu.
